#fae1cc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#fae1cc is composed of 98% red, 88.2% green and 80%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 10% magenta, 18.4% yellow and 2% black. It has a hue angle of 27.4 degrees, a saturation of 82.1% and a lightness of 89%. #fae1cc color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#f5c399. Closest websafe color is: #ffcccc.

● #fae1cc color description : Light grayish orange.
#fae1cc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#fae1cc has RGB values of R:250, G:225, B:204 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.1, Y:0.18, K:0.02. Its decimal value is 16441804.
